1992 Nissan Sunny vs. 1992 Peugeot 205
To start off, both 1992 Nissan Sunny and 1992 Peugeot 205 were released in the same year (1992).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 1,971 cc (4 cylinders), 1992 Nissan Sunny is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1992 Peugeot 205 (104 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 30 more horse power than 1992 Nissan Sunny. (74 HP @ 4800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1992 Peugeot 205 should accelerate faster than 1992 Nissan Sunny.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1992 Peugeot 205 (144 Nm @ 3000 RPM) has 12 more torque (in Nm) than 1992 Nissan Sunny. (132 Nm @ 2800 RPM). This means 1992 Peugeot 205 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1992 Nissan Sunny.
